Westwood board approves WEA contract extension through July 31, 2028
Summary
After a closed session on labor negotiations, the Westwood Community School District Board approved an extension of the Westwood Education Association (WEA) contract by a 5-0 vote; the contract will be effective through July 31, 2028.

The Westwood Community School District Board unanimously approved an extension of the Westwood Education Association contract on April 20, 2026.
The minutes record: “Added agenda item: Approval of the WEA contract extension. Vice President Timothy Emery moved, and Treasurer Roderick Means seconded approval of the contract extension as presented. The motion passed unanimously, 5-0. The WEA contract will be effective until July 31, 2028.” The vote occurred after a closed session on negotiations with the WEA; the board entered that closed session at 8:05 p.m. and returned to open session at 8:30 p.m.
The minutes do not specify contract terms or dollar amounts; they record only the board’s approval and the effective date through July 31, 2028. The approval was recorded 5-0, reflecting that Trustee Narabia Little had left the meeting earlier at 8:01 p.m.
